In PBR channels the Normal map expertly conveys the micro-relief of snow particles and small ridges formed by wind and natural settling providing depth and tactile realism. The Roughness map reflects the variable surface finish balancing areas of soft powdery snow with patches of slightly glazed compacted ice ensuring convincing light scattering and reflection behavior. The Metallic channel remains near zero consistent with snow’s non-metallic nature while Ambient Occlusion adds subtle shadowing in crevices and depressions enhancing depth perception. The Height/Displacement map captures the uneven terrain of snow-covered ground allowing precise parallax or tessellation effects for immersive virtual environments. This texture is provided in ultra-high 8K resolution ensuring crisp detail even in close-up views and is fully optimized for seamless use in Blender Unreal Engine and Unity supporting realistic winter landscapes and seasonal outdoor scenes.
To maximize realism in your projects consider adjusting the UV scale to finely tune the snow pattern’s density relative to your scene’s scale—larger UVs emphasize broad snow fields while smaller UVs highlight granular detail. Additionally fine-tuning the Roughness parameter can simulate different snow conditions from freshly fallen powder to compacted icy surfaces. Using This PBR Texture in Blender
Import the texture maps into Blender with sRGB color space for albedo/base color and
Non-Color for normal, roughness, metallic, AO, height, and ORM maps. Connect normal maps
through a Normal Map node, then adjust UV scale with a Mapping node so the material repeats naturally on
your model.
- Albedo -> Principled BSDF Base Color
- Roughness -> Roughness, Metallic -> Metallic
- Normal -> Normal Map node -> Normal
- Height -> Bump or Displacement depending on render setup
